
Standalone: Okhla landfill site in Delhi
New Delhi: Dumpers and excavators at Okhla landfill site, in New Delhi, Friday, June 6, 2025. (PTI Photo) (PTI06_06_2025_000401B)
New Delhi: Dumpers and excavators at Okhla landfill site, in New Delhi, Friday, June 6, 2025. (PTI Photo) (PTI06_06_2025_000401B)